The ingredients needed to make Brad's pickled ham & bean soup w/ cheesey English muffins:
  1. Prepare 2 (15 Oz) cans pinto beans
  2. Prepare 1 lb ham steak, cubed
  3. Get 12 small onion, chopped
  4. Take Half tbs garlic powder
  5. Take 1 tsp each; white pepper, mustard seed,
  6. Prepare 12 tsp smoked paprika, Chile flakes,
  7. Get 2 bay leaves
  8. Make ready 4-6 allspice berries, depending on size
  9. Make ready 2 tbs cider vinegar
  10. Make ready Mesa flour
  11. Prepare For the muffins
  12. Make ready 4 English muffins, split
  13. Prepare Butter
  14. Get 8 slices cheddar cheese
  15. Make ready Fresh rosemary
  16. Prepare Tobasco sauce

Steps to make Brad's pickled ham & bean soup w/ cheesey English muffins:
  1. Add beans, onions, and ham to a LG saucepot. Just cover with water.
  2. Add rest of the bean ingredients except mesa. Bring to a simmer. Simmer 20-25 minutes. Stir often.
  3. Heat a dry fry pan over medium low heat. Butter split muffins. Toast in pan until golden brown.
  4. Place on a baking sheet. Place a cheese slice on top. Bake at 425 until cheese is well melted. 5-7 minutes
  5. While bean soup is simmering, slowly add Mesa stirring constantly until soup is desired consistency. I used a little over 18 of a cup.
  6. Put bean soup in a bowl. Arrange muffins on top. Garnish with fresh rosemary and a few drops of tobasco sauce. Serve immediately. Enjoy.
